Herbal healing is most effective when seamlessly integrated into your daily routine. Here are some simple ways to ensure herbs become a regular part of your wellness journey.
Tips for Daily Herbal Use:
Start your morning with an herbal infusion or tea.
Here are some suggestions for caffeine free Energy and Focus;
Peppermint & Ginger: This combination provides a refreshing and invigorating flavor while potentially aiding digestion and increasing alertness.
Ginseng & Gotu Kola: Ginseng is known for its ability to combat fatigue and improve focus, while Gotu Kola supports mental clarity.
Yerba Mate & Lemon Balm: Yerba Mate offers a natural, sustained energy boost, and Lemon Balm can enhance mental clarity and promote a calm focus.
Use herbal tinctures or capsules with meals.
Incorporate fresh or dried herbs into your cooking.
Keep a small herbal first-aid kit for quick relief.
Create self-care rituals with herbal baths or salves.
Luxurious Skin Care Salve Recipe
Use this whenever, but after an evening bath elevates an evening routine.
Yields: Approximately 8 oz.
Ingredients:
1 cup (8 ounces) olive oil, jojoba oil, or sweet almond oil.
¼ cup (1 oz) beeswax pastilles or pellets.
1-2 Tbsp shea butter, cocoa butter, or mango butter.
Up to 1 tsp essential oils like lavender, bergamot, or neroli (100 drops maximum for safety, but consider using ¼ to ½ tsp or less for a lighter scent).
½ tsp Vitamin E Oil
Melt the base: In the top of a double boiler, combine the carrier oil(s), beeswax, and shea butter.
Heat gently: Fill the bottom of the double boiler with water and heat over medium-high heat until all ingredients are completely melted and combined, stirring occasionally.
Cool slightly: Remove the double boiler from the heat and allow the mixture to cool slightly.
Stir in essential oils and vitamin E oil.
Pour into containers: Carefully pour the liquid salve into your chosen storage containers.
Harden and store: Allow the salve to cool completely and harden at room temperature for several hours or overnight. Once hardened, add lids and labels. Store in a cool, dry place.
